If you’re in downtown Middlebury in December, keep your eyes peeled for tiny holiday chickens hidden in 10 store windows. Find them all and you’ll be entered to win $100 in Middlebury Money, or to win the chickens — miniature framed original illustrations by children’s author Ashley Wolff — themselves.
